what is the product of -3a and -6a​

Answer:

18a^2

Step-by-step explanation:

Multiply the numbers together. Multiply the variables together.

(-3a)(-6a) = (-3) * (-6) * a * a = 18a^2

-3 times -6 = 18 since negative times negative is positive, and 3 * 6 = 18.

Also a * a = a^2.

Answer: 18a^2
